# Mocking Request
|
|
|
|
Undici has its own mocking [utility](/docs/docs/api/MockAgent.md). It allow us to intercept undici HTTP requests and return mocked values instead. It can be useful for testing purposes.
|
|
|
|
Example:
|
|
|
|
```js
|
|
// bank.mjs
|
|
import { request } from 'undici'
|
|
|
|
export async function bankTransfer(recipient, amount) {
|
|
const { body } = await request('http://localhost:3000/bank-transfer',
|
|
{
|
|
method: 'POST',
|
|
headers: {
|
|
'X-TOKEN-SECRET': 'SuperSecretToken',
|
|
},
|
|
body: JSON.stringify({
|
|
recipient,
|
|
amount
|
|
})
|
|
}
|
|
)
|
|
return await body.json()
|
|
}
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
And this is what the test file looks like:
|
|
|
|
```js
|
|
// index.test.mjs
|
|
import { strict as assert } from 'node:assert'
|
|
import { MockAgent, setGlobalDispatcher, } from 'undici'
|
|
import { bankTransfer } from './bank.mjs'
|
|
|
|
const mockAgent = new MockAgent();
|
|
|
|
setGlobalDispatcher(mockAgent);
|
|
|
|
// Provide the base url to the request
|
|
const mockPool = mockAgent.get('http://localhost:3000');
|
|
|
|
// intercept the request
|
|
mockPool.intercept({
|
|
path: '/bank-transfer',
|
|
method: 'POST',
|
|
headers: {
|
|
'X-TOKEN-SECRET': 'SuperSecretToken',
|
|
},
|
|
body: JSON.stringify({
|
|
recipient: '1234567890',
|
|
amount: '100'
|
|
})
|
|
}).reply(200, {
|
|
message: 'transaction processed'
|
|
})
|
|
|
|
const success = await bankTransfer('1234567890', '100')
|
|
|
|
assert.deepEqual(success, { message: 'transaction processed' })
|
|
|
|
// if you dont want to check whether the body or the headers contain the same value
|
|
// just remove it from interceptor
|
|
mockPool.intercept({
|
|
path: '/bank-transfer',
|
|
method: 'POST',
|
|
}).reply(400, {
|
|
message: 'bank account not found'
|
|
})
|
|
|
|
const badRequest = await bankTransfer('1234567890', '100')
|
|
|
|
assert.deepEqual(badRequest, { message: 'bank account not found' })
|
|
```

## Access agent call history
|
|
|
|
Using a MockAgent also allows you to make assertions on the configuration used to make your request in your application.
|
|
|
|
Here is an example :
|
|
|
|
```js
|
|
// index.test.mjs
|
|
import { strict as assert } from 'node:assert'
|
|
import { MockAgent, setGlobalDispatcher, fetch } from 'undici'
|
|
import { app } from './app.mjs'
|
|
|
|
// given an application server running on http://localhost:3000
|
|
await app.start()
|
|
|
|
// enable call history at instantiation
|
|
const mockAgent = new MockAgent({ enableCallHistory: true })
|
|
// or after instantiation
|
|
mockAgent.enableCallHistory()
|
|
|
|
setGlobalDispatcher(mockAgent)
|
|
|
|
// this call is made (not intercepted)
|
|
await fetch(`http://localhost:3000/endpoint?query='hello'`, {
|
|
method: 'POST',
|
|
headers: { 'content-type': 'application/json' }
|
|
body: JSON.stringify({ data: '' })
|
|
})
|
|
|
|
// access to the call history of the MockAgent (which register every call made intercepted or not)
|
|
assert.ok(mockAgent.getCallHistory()?.calls().length === 1)
|
|
assert.strictEqual(mockAgent.getCallHistory()?.firstCall()?.fullUrl, `http://localhost:3000/endpoint?query='hello'`)
|
|
assert.strictEqual(mockAgent.getCallHistory()?.firstCall()?.body, JSON.stringify({ data: '' }))
|
|
assert.deepStrictEqual(mockAgent.getCallHistory()?.firstCall()?.searchParams, { query: 'hello' })
|
|
assert.strictEqual(mockAgent.getCallHistory()?.firstCall()?.port, '3000')
|
|
assert.strictEqual(mockAgent.getCallHistory()?.firstCall()?.host, 'localhost:3000')
|
|
assert.strictEqual(mockAgent.getCallHistory()?.firstCall()?.method, 'POST')
|
|
assert.strictEqual(mockAgent.getCallHistory()?.firstCall()?.path, '/endpoint')
|
|
assert.deepStrictEqual(mockAgent.getCallHistory()?.firstCall()?.headers, { 'content-type': 'application/json' })
|
|
|
|
// clear all call history logs
|
|
mockAgent.clearCallHistory()
|
|
|
|
assert.ok(mockAgent.getCallHistory()?.calls().length === 0)
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
Calling `mockAgent.close()` will automatically clear and delete every call history for you.

## Debug Mock Value
|
|
|
|
When the interceptor and the request options are not the same, undici will automatically make a real HTTP request. To prevent real requests from being made, use `mockAgent.disableNetConnect()`:
|
|
|
|
```js
|
|
const mockAgent = new MockAgent();
|
|
|
|
setGlobalDispatcher(mockAgent);
|
|
mockAgent.disableNetConnect()
|
|
|
|
// Provide the base url to the request
|
|
const mockPool = mockAgent.get('http://localhost:3000');
|
|
|
|
mockPool.intercept({
|
|
path: '/bank-transfer',
|
|
method: 'POST',
|
|
}).reply(200, {
|
|
message: 'transaction processed'
|
|
})
|
|
|
|
const badRequest = await bankTransfer('1234567890', '100')
|
|
// Will throw an error
|
|
// MockNotMatchedError: Mock dispatch not matched for path '/bank-transfer':
|
|
// subsequent request to origin http://localhost:3000 was not allowed (net.connect disabled)
|
|
```

## Reply with data based on request
|
|
|
|
If the mocked response needs to be dynamically derived from the request parameters, you can provide a function instead of an object to `reply`:
|
|
|
|
```js
|
|
mockPool.intercept({
|
|
path: '/bank-transfer',
|
|
method: 'POST',
|
|
headers: {
|
|
'X-TOKEN-SECRET': 'SuperSecretToken',
|
|
},
|
|
body: JSON.stringify({
|
|
recipient: '1234567890',
|
|
amount: '100'
|
|
})
|
|
}).reply(200, (opts) => {
|
|
// do something with opts
|
|
|
|
return { message: 'transaction processed' }
|
|
})
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
in this case opts will be
|
|
|
|
```
|
|
{
|
|
method: 'POST',
|
|
headers: { 'X-TOKEN-SECRET': 'SuperSecretToken' },
|
|
body: '{"recipient":"1234567890","amount":"100"}',
|
|
origin: 'http://localhost:3000',
|
|
path: '/bank-transfer'
|
|
}
|
|
```
